Indonesia’s President Prabowo Subianto has made headlines at the United Nations in New York by restating that Indonesia will recognise Israel, but only if Palestine is granted full statehood. Speaking during a high-level session on the two-state solution co-hosted by France and Saudi Arabia, Prabowo declared, “Once Israel recognises Palestinian independence, Indonesia will immediately recognise Israel.” The statement marks the strongest signal yet of a potential Indonesia–Israel normalisation, sparking debate over Jakarta’s long-standing foreign policy.
